新聞中心
服務器變卡的原因可能涉及多個方面,從硬件故障到軟件配置問題,以及外部因素都可能導致服務器性能下降,以下是一些常見的原因和分析:

成都創(chuàng)新互聯(lián)專注于網(wǎng)站建設,為客戶提供網(wǎng)站制作、成都網(wǎng)站設計、網(wǎng)頁設計開發(fā)服務,多年建網(wǎng)站服務經(jīng)驗,各類網(wǎng)站都可以開發(fā),品牌網(wǎng)站制作,公司官網(wǎng),公司展示網(wǎng)站,網(wǎng)站設計,建網(wǎng)站費用,建網(wǎng)站多少錢,價格優(yōu)惠,收費合理。
1、硬件資源瓶頸
CPU過載:當服務器的CPU使用率長時間接近或達到100%,會導致處理速度變慢,響應時間增加。
內(nèi)存不足:如果服務器運行的程序需要的內(nèi)存超過了實際可用的內(nèi)存,系統(tǒng)會使用交換空間(swap),這將大幅度降低運行速度。
磁盤I/O瓶頸:磁盤讀寫速度慢或者磁盤I/O等待過高也會引起卡頓,特別是在高并發(fā)讀寫操作時更為明顯。
網(wǎng)絡帶寬限制:如果服務器的網(wǎng)絡帶寬被大量數(shù)據(jù)流量占滿,將導致數(shù)據(jù)傳輸緩慢,進而影響整體性能。
2、軟件配置不當
錯誤的系統(tǒng)配置:例如內(nèi)核參數(shù)設置不當、系統(tǒng)服務配置錯誤等都可能引起性能問題。
應用程序配置:應用服務器的配置不當,如數(shù)據(jù)庫查詢優(yōu)化不佳、緩存策略不合理等,都會導致服務器響應變慢。
資源管理不當:比如未能正確分配系統(tǒng)資源給關鍵進程,或者沒有對資源密集型任務進行適當?shù)南拗坪驼{(diào)度。
3、程序代碼問題
代碼效率低下:程序中可能存在算法效率不高、循環(huán)次數(shù)過多等代碼層面的問題。
內(nèi)存泄漏:程序長時間運行后未釋放不再使用的內(nèi)存,導致可用內(nèi)存逐漸減少,進而影響性能。
4、系統(tǒng)負載過高
并發(fā)用戶數(shù)過多:同時訪問服務器的用戶數(shù)量超出服務器處理能力,導致系統(tǒng)資源競爭加劇。
大量短任務:系統(tǒng)處理大量短期任務時,頻繁的任務切換也會消耗不少系統(tǒng)資源。
5、安全問題
遭受攻擊:如DDoS攻擊會使服務器網(wǎng)絡帶寬飽和,而惡意軟件或病毒則可能消耗大量的系統(tǒng)資源。
安全策略過度:過于嚴格的安全策略可能導致正常業(yè)務流程被限制,從而影響性能。
6、操作系統(tǒng)問題
系統(tǒng)更新不及時:未及時應用操作系統(tǒng)的補丁和更新可能會導致已知的性能問題未被解決。
驅(qū)動程序不兼容:錯誤的或者過時的驅(qū)動程序可能會造成硬件設備運行不正常。
7、外部服務依賴
依賴的外部服務不穩(wěn)定或響應慢,如數(shù)據(jù)庫服務器、API服務等,都會間接影響自身服務器的性能。
相關問題與解答:
Q1: 如何檢測服務器是否遭受DDoS攻擊?
A1: 可以使用網(wǎng)絡監(jiān)控工具檢查流量異常,若發(fā)現(xiàn)大量來自非正常使用模式的流量,可能是遭受了DDoS攻擊,應立即啟用防御措施并通知服務提供商。
Q2: 服務器出現(xiàn)性能瓶頸時,應該首先檢查哪些指標?
A2: 應首先檢查CPU、內(nèi)存、磁盤I/O和網(wǎng)絡帶寬的使用情況,這些是最常見的性能瓶頸來源。
Q3: 內(nèi)存泄漏應如何排查?
A3: 可以使用性能分析工具,如Linux下的valgrind,來監(jiān)測程序運行時的內(nèi)存使用情況,從而定位內(nèi)存泄漏的位置。
Q4: 如何優(yōu)化數(shù)據(jù)庫查詢以提升服務器性能?
A4: 可以對查詢語句進行優(yōu)化,添加合適的索引,減少不必要的數(shù)據(jù)加載,以及使用緩存機制減輕數(shù)據(jù)庫負擔。
本文標題:服務器變卡的原因有哪些(服務器卡頓的原因分析)
當前鏈接:http://m.fisionsoft.com.cn/article/dhjeiih.html


咨詢
建站咨詢
